It’s not news that there can be many problems of latchkey living.

Researchers find that 51% of “latchkey kids” are doing poorly in school. Meanwhile, the study by the Carnegie Council on teenager development shows that children going home alone after school for 11 hours or more each week are twice as likely to use drugs and alcohol.

Are there any positives of latchkey living? Yes, says Renee Peterson Trudeau, an internationally recognized life balance coach. “Some of the most successful people were latchkey kids growing up,” she says. “Young people who are allowed more freedom to be on their own often become more independent.”

Are you a parent of “latchkey kids”? Here are some tips for you to make your children’s home-alone life a safe, growing opportunity.

●Keep in touch. Always make sure your child can reach you. For example, have your child call you when he gets home from school, and then call him as you’re leaving work.

●Keep busy. It’s not a bad idea to have your kids feed the pet or water the flowers before you get home. Chores teach them responsibility.

●Keep an eye. If you have a neighbor, kindly ask her if she could pay attention from time to time. This makes you know whether your child is telling the truth.

●Keep communication. Take the time to keep up with how your kid’s afternoons are going.

Make sure he is clear of your time-alone rules for him, especially around screen time and homework.

“If you follow the suggestions above, you shouldn’t feel regretful for being a working parent.” Renee says. “They are more confident around problem solving.”
